Even before the Everest trip, James Morris had had a varied life. Name variations: James Morris. [19], Reporting from Cyprus on the Suez Crisis for the Manchester Guardian in 1956, Morris produced the first "irrefutable proof" of collusion between France and Israel in the invasion of Egyptian territory, interviewing French Air Force pilots who confirmed that they had been in action in support of Israeli forces. Her work contributed to the resignation of British Prime Minister Anthony Eden some months later and to the withdrawal of British troops from Egypt. The couple first met on an Arabic course in London, after Morris had finished his military service as an intelligence officer in Italy and Palestine following graduation from Oxford. More than half a century ago, James Humphrey Morris was the most famous newspaper journalist in Britain.
